I will tag @Miss Lydia, and you may also get advice on the duck forum. B complex 1/4 ground onto some food would be good. Actually Poultry NutriDrench has B vitamins as well, but does not have riboflavin or B2. B3 or niacin is more important in ducks though. Liquid b complex or tablets. I am afraid if you put the duckling back with the group you’ll lose it. It’s going to try an keep up and it won’t be able to an it will give up. Best would be to keep it inside in a brooder with one more for company.
